Minutes — Management Meeting, Halloran Group

Present: operations, procurement, finance leads. Sole agenda item: renewal of the supply contract with Merrowvale Components. Agreed to extend for two years with a 3% volume rebate and quarterly quality reviews. Finance to confirm payment terms; procurement to issue the revised draft within ten days. The confidential planning note follows below.

internal memo for kawip-hadug: Headcount on the Wenwyn team goes from 7 to 140 by the end of January. Gross margin on Wenwyn came in at 20 percent against a plan of 15 percent.

Handover note — Crumbwheel order cutoffs.

Welcome aboard. The bakery cutoff rule in Crumbwheel closes same-day orders at 14:00 local to each storefront, not UTC — this has bitten us twice. Holiday overrides live in the calendar service and take precedence silently, so always check there first when a cutoff looks wrong. To unlock the calendar service's admin console after a restart, enter the recovery passphrase below.

vault phrase of bagap-bahaf = silion-pelox-sorox-casdor-quenwyn-fraax-eliox-praael-kelion-quenvan-kasox-rusael-norius-belvan

## Authentication

The Nightshade admin dashboard's dark-mode settings live behind the same auth wall as everything else — no anonymous theme toggling here. Theme preferences are stored per-account server-side, so the security surface is just the standard API. For local review builds, the dev server expects a bearer token on every request. Use the one provided below.

session JWT of yawep-yawep = eyJhbGciOiJIUzI1NiIsInR5cCI6IkpXVCJ9.eyJzdWIiOiI3pWF3_In0.aXYsHiog